Deep Time Earth is built on the following open datasets and tools.

Data Sources

PaleoDEM

CC BY 4.0

Paleodigital Elevation Models (0–540 Ma heightmaps)

Scotese, C.R. and Wright, N.M. (2018). PALEOMAP Paleodigital Elevation Models (PaleoDEMS) for the Phanerozoic.

DOI: 10.5281/zenodo.5460860

Modifications: NetCDF → WebP conversion, resized to 4096×2048, flood-fill coastline cleanup, narrow-strait dilation preservation, Natural Earth mask correction for shallow seas at 0Ma·5Ma

Natural Earth

Public Domain

Ocean / marine polygons for shallow-sea correction at 0Ma·5Ma (modern coastline)

Natural Earth — naturalearthdata.com

Modifications: ne_10m_ocean + ne_10m_marine_polys GeoJSON converted to 4096×2048 boolean mask, applied as sea overlay in the final heightmap stage

CESM paleoclimate simulation

CC BY 4.0

0–540 Ma temperature / precipitation / wind (55 snapshots, 10 Ma → 109 snapshots interpolated to 5 Ma)

Li, X. et al. (2022). A high-resolution climate simulation dataset for the past 540 million years. Scientific Data, 9, 371.

DOI: 10.1038/s41597-022-01490-4

Modifications: NetCDF → RGB WebP/PNG textures (temp/precip/land fraction/wind), upscaled 192×288 → 4096×2048, linearly interpolated from 10 Ma to 5 Ma

PBDB

CC BY 4.0

Paleobiology Database (fossil occurrence records)

Peters, S.E. and McClennen, M. (2016). The Paleobiology Database application programming interface. Paleobiology, 42(1), 1-7.

Modifications: Up to 10,000 occurrences sampled per time slice (stratified by class); rotated to paleocoordinates with PyGPlates. The primary reference for each occurrence can be looked up by occurrence ID at paleobiodb.org.

GPlates / PyGPlates

CC BY 3.0 (data) / GPL v2 (software)

Plate-tectonic coordinate reconstruction (run locally)

Müller, R.D. et al. (2018). GPlates: Building a Virtual Earth Through Deep Time. G-cubed, 19.

DOI: 10.1029/2018GC007584

Modifications: Coordinates pre-computed locally with PyGPlates and stored as static JSON

SETON2012 rotation model

CC BY 3.0

0–200 Ma coordinate reconstruction + plate boundaries

Seton, M. et al. (2012). Global continental and ocean basin reconstructions since 200 Ma. Earth-Science Reviews, 113.

DOI: 10.5281/zenodo.10596049

PALEOMAP PaleoAtlas (rotation model)

CC BY 4.0

200–540 Ma coordinate reconstruction (Scotese 2016 reference frame, aligned with PaleoDEM heightmap)

Scotese, C.R. (2016). PALEOMAP PaleoAtlas for GPlates. Zenodo.

DOI: 10.5281/zenodo.10596609

Modifications: Pre-rotated fossil/city/geo_event coordinates with PyGPlates and stored as static JSON

Müller 2022 rotation model

CC BY 4.0

200–540 Ma plate boundary topology

Müller, R.D. et al. (2022). A tectonic-rules-based mantle reference frame since 1 billion years ago. ESSD.

DOI: 10.5281/zenodo.10297173

PhyloPic

Per-image — CC0 / CC BY / CC BY-ND only (NC·SA blocked)

Taxon silhouette images (fossil hover tooltips — runtime API)

PhyloPic — phylopic.org

Modifications: Runtime API calls; per-artist attribution and license label shown in the UI
